The majority of Keely’s position is overseeing Club Advisory Board (CAB). CAB helps clubs and organizations plan successful events by allocating funds and facilitating workshops that provide valuable information for club and organization leadership. CAB workshops are open to all students and provide valuable information. Every club and organization represented at the workshops has the chance to win $50.00. The CAB committee meets weekly with different clubs and organizations. CAB members are often the first to become aware of all the activities and events that are occurring on the U of R campus. Some events that CAB plans every year are involvement fairs, and the Keli'ikoa conferences. Also, at the end of the school year, CAB holds the annual CAB Awards Banquet to honor students, clubs, organizations, and advisors.
